Brandt CO29AWLU Refrigerator F.A.Q.

How do I adjust the temperature settings on my Brandt CO29AWLU Refrigerator?

To adjust the temperature, locate the control panel inside the refrigerator. Use the temperature adjustment buttons to set your desired cooling level. The ideal temperature for the refrigerator compartment is between 3°C and 5°C.

What should I do if my refrigerator is not cooling properly?

First, ensure that the refrigerator is plugged in and the power is on. Check the temperature settings and make sure the door seals are intact. If the issue persists, clean the condenser coils and ensure there is adequate ventilation around the unit.

How often should I clean the condenser coils on my Brandt CO29AWLU Refrigerator?

It is recommended to clean the condenser coils every six months to maintain optimal performance. Use a vacuum cleaner or a brush to remove dust and debris.

Can I change the door swing direction on my refrigerator?

Yes, the Brandt CO29AWLU Refrigerator allows you to change the door swing direction. Refer to the user manual for detailed instructions and ensure you have the necessary tools before starting the process.

What should I do if my refrigerator is making unusual noises?

Unusual noises can be caused by the refrigerator not being level or items inside touching the walls. Ensure the unit is stable and remove any items causing vibrations. If the noise persists, contact a professional technician.

How can I prevent ice buildup in the freezer compartment?

Ensure the freezer door is closed tightly and the seals are in good condition. Avoid placing hot or warm items directly into the freezer. Regularly defrost the freezer if ice buildup exceeds 5mm.

What is the best way to clean the interior of my refrigerator?

Remove all food items and detachable shelves. Use a mixture of warm water and mild detergent to wipe the interior surfaces. Rinse with clean water and dry with a soft cloth before replacing the shelves and food items.

How can I improve the energy efficiency of my Brandt CO29AWLU Refrigerator?

Keep the refrigerator away from heat sources and ensure it has adequate ventilation. Regularly check the door seals for any gaps and avoid overfilling the compartments to ensure proper air circulation.

Why does my refrigerator's light not turn on when I open the door?

First, check if the bulb needs replacement. If the bulb is functional, inspect the door switch for any malfunctions. If necessary, consult a technician to diagnose and fix the problem.

Is it normal for the back of my refrigerator to feel warm?

Yes, it is normal for the back of the refrigerator to feel warm as it releases heat through the condenser coils. However, ensure the area is well-ventilated to prevent overheating.
